What is the Tourneo?
2 Answers
Tourneo is a commercial vehicle launched by Ford. Taking the 2020 Ford Tourneo as an example, it is equipped with a 2.0T inline 4-cylinder tur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 203PS, a maximum torque of 300Nm, and a maximum power output of 149kW. The engine reaches its peak power at 5000rpm and peak torque at 3000rpm, paired with a 6-speed automatic transmission. The 2020 Ford Tourneo has body dimensions of 4976mm in length, 2095mm in width, and 1990m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2933mm, a minimum ground clearance of 149mm, and a curb weight of 2235kg.
